Microsoft Office

Overview

Microsoft Office is an office suite of desktop applications, servers and services for the Microsoft Windows and OS X operating systems.

Available to

  • Faculty
  • Students
  • Staff

Where to Get it

Current students, faculty and staff can download Microsoft Office for free. More information here.

Faculty and staff can purchase a single copy through the Microsoft Home Use Program. More information here.

(If you need Microsoft Office for your ODU workstation, contact the ITS Help Desk.)

Also available to access via:

  • ITS Labs
  • Monarch Virtual Environment (MoVE)

Platform Requirements

  • Windows 7+ (Office 2013)
  • Mac OS X 10.10+ (Office 2016)
  • Mac OS X 10.6+ (Office 2011)

Office 2013 Access

Access

A database management system that combines the relational Microsoft Jet Database Engine with a graphical user interface and software development tools. (Windows only.)
